Janez Baptist Novak
Janez Baptist Novak (also Janez Krstnik Novak ; * around 1756 in Laibach ; † January 29, 1833 ibid) was a Slovenian composer .
Novak was one of the founders of the Laibach Philharmonic Society, where he was music director from 1808 to 1825.
A cantata and incidental music in the style of Mozart have survived from his compositions .
